5f316d1cc0 libgdata: drop due to upstream archival
libgdata was archived upstream, as can be seen in the GitLab repository:
https://gitlab.gnome.org/Archive/libgdata. Additionally, it relies on
libsoup 2.4, which is known to be insecure. The only effort to migrate
stalled out for years in
https://gitlab.gnome.org/Archive/libgdata/-/merge_requests/49, even
before the archival. Since there are no in-tree dependents, this seems
harmless to drop.

Maciej Krüger
f2ba699f37 fetchPnpmDeps: fix reproducibility of pnpm v11 store index
The pnpm v11 store uses a SQLite database (index.db) whose binary format
is non-deterministic across platforms (version-valid-for number, etc).
This caused hash mismatches when building the same pnpmDeps on different
machines despite identical logical content.

Fix by dumping the SQLite database to a text SQL file during the fetch
phase and reconstructing it during the build phase. This ensures the
stored representation is fully deterministic.

127a52082d buildRustCrate: add extraRustcOptsForProcMacro
Proc-macro crates are host dylibs that rustc dlopen()s. Instrumentation
flags passed via extraRustcOpts (e.g. -Zsanitizer=address,
-Cinstrument-coverage) leave unresolved runtime symbols in those dylibs
and break the build. Cargo avoids this by not applying RUSTFLAGS to host
artifacts; buildRustCrate already has extraRustcOptsForBuildRs for build
scripts, so add the analogous knob for proc-macros.

Defaults to null, which falls back to extraRustcOpts so existing callers
are unchanged. Set to [] to opt proc-macros out when applying
sanitizer/coverage flags tree-wide via crateOverrides.
